Domino is a board game whose origins date back to the early 18th century. From its origins in Europe, it spread throughout the continent, eventually reaching southern Germany and Austria. It also made its way to England, where it was introduced by French prisoners of war. By the early 1860s, the game had reached the United States, where it became so popular that it was played in cafes. The European version of the game differs slightly from the Chinese version, but still maintains many of the same features.

The name of the game derives from the Venetian Carnival costume of the “domino”, which consists of a black robe and a white mask. It is not linked to the number 2 in any language. Some of the most popular versions of Domino include the Domino Whist, Matador, and Texas 42. Other popular forms are the Double Fives and Mexican Train. The British version of the game is known as Fives and Threes.
